NCT ID: NCT05186116 Recruiting - Clinical trials for Liver Metastasis Colon Cancer

LDLT in Non Resectable Colo-rectal Cancer Liver Metastasis

LIVERMORE
Start date: January 1, 2022
Phase: N/A
Study type: Interventional

This study is an interventional open label prospective study that aims to assess both overall and disease-free survival of patients treated with LDLT, partial or whole graft LT from deceased donors for unresectable CRLM. Secondary outcomes are graft survival and donor outcomes in terms of safety and quality of life. Donor selection is performed according to the currently used Institutional and National standards and protocols.

NCT ID: NCT05174169 Recruiting - Clinical trials for Stage III Colon Cancer

Colon Adjuvant Chemotherapy Based on Evaluation of Residual Disease

CIRCULATE-US
Start date: March 10, 2022
Phase: Phase 2/Phase 3
Study type: Interventional

This Phase II/III trial will evaluate the what kind of chemotherapy to recommend to patients based on the presence or absences of circulating tumor DNA (ctDNA) after surgery for colon cancer.

NCT ID: NCT05133544 Recruiting - Colonic Polyp Clinical Trials

Endocuff With or Without AI-assisted Colonoscopy

Start date: May 1, 2022
Phase: N/A
Study type: Interventional

Colonoscopy is considered the gold standard for diagnosis of colonic polyps. However, it was reported that colonoscopy could still miss colonic polyps. Many attempts have been made to improve the detection rate of colonoscopy. Artificial intelligence (AI) is a promising new technique to improve detection rate of colonic adenoma. However, it remains uncertain whether whether the combined use of Endocuff and AI assisted examination could help to further improve the adenoma detection rate. This is a prospective randomized trial comparing the use of endocuff with AI, AI alone or conventional colonoscopy examination on adenoma detection rate.

NCT ID: NCT05068180 Recruiting - Prostatic Neoplasms Clinical Trials

Low-dose Neuroleptanalgesia for Postoperative Delirium in Elderly Patients

Start date: October 5, 2021
Phase: Phase 4
Study type: Interventional

Postoperative delirium(POD)is a common complication that can directly affect important clinical outcomes, and exert an enormous burden on patients, their families, hospitals, and public resources. In order to evaluate whether an intraoperative administration of low-dose neuroleptanalgesia reduces postoperative delirium, droperidol 1.25 mg and fentanyl 0.025 mg or normal saline is used by intravenous injection 30 minutes before the end of the operation, in elderly patients with non-cardiac major surgery under general anesthesia. The efficiency and safety of neuroleptanalgesia on the incidence of POD would be evaluated in elderly patients.

NCT ID: NCT05062889 Recruiting - Clinical trials for Stage III Colon Cancer

Exploiting Circulating Tumour DNA to Intensify the Postoperative Treatment Resected Colon Cancer Patients

ERASE-CRC
Start date: May 17, 2023
Phase: Phase 2
Study type: Interventional

The aims of this study are to evaluate if an intensified adjuvant treatment with FOLFOXIRI could increase the rate of cases with undetectable ct-DNA after chemotherapy and to evaluate if a further adjuvant treatment with Trifluridine/Tipiracil could increase the rate of cases with undetectable ct-DNA and therefore improve DFS in a population at high-risk of relapse. An additional target-driven cohort of HER2+ RAS wild-type colon cancer patients will be assessed for ct-DNA clearance after a tailored treatment with Trastuzumab and Tucatinib plus FOLFOX
